Duties and Responsibilities:
- Provide direct instruction in academic, adaptive, and life skills to students with visual impairments
- Assess student functional vision and orientation and mobility needs
- Develop and implement individualized instruction based on IEP goals
- Consult with classroom teachers and staff to adapt materials and curriculum
- Train students in the use of assistive technology and orientation strategies
- Monitor and document student progress, maintaining compliance with educational requirements
- Support families with resources and strategies for helping their children succeed at home and in the community
